Nan Miller

Shepherd for Chicago and I:58

Nan’s heart is with the vulnerable whose walls have been broken because of bad choices made, or things done to them, or the brokenness of life and her desire is that God will rebuild their lives. This desire has led her to minister in the neighborhood of Little Village on the west side and teaming up with two other Navstaff women in a discipleship house.  Nan also serves as a city leader and shepherd of Navigator staff for the I-58 mission in Chicago. In her early days with the Navigators she caught the vision of multiplication and believes God for spiritual generations of laborers flowing from her life all over the world.
